We are seeking a collaborative, highly vigilant, and hands-on Manager / Senior Manager, Artist Budget & Expense Management to lead our budget control, internal expense audit, and travel operations functions. Reporting directly to the VP of Finance, this inward-facing operational leader will act as a primary gatekeeper for financial governance—building robust internal controls, evaluating expense workflows for vulnerabilities, and preventing unauthorized spending or fraud. This position balances strategic control-building with daily operational execution. You will manage a small direct team while actively reviewing invoices, auditing BREX credit card activity, and ensuring all expenses fall strictly within approved artist and label budgets.

Responsibilities

  • Design, implement, and maintain internal control frameworks across accounts payable, BREX corporate cards, and travel operations to prevent fraud, waste, and unauthorized label spending.
  • Continuously evaluate existing expense workflows, technology platforms, and approval chains to identify control deficiencies, operational risks, or governance loopholes.
  • Conduct spot-audits and pre-payment reviews of high-risk expense categories (e.g., video shoots, live events, touring advances) to catch duplicate billings, inflated costs, or altered vendor documents.
  • Establish automated "red-flag" metrics within BREX and AP systems to detect unusual spending patterns; partner with the VP of Finance and Legal to address compliance breaches.
  • Maintain direct involvement in daily financial workflows by actively reviewing and approving invoices and expense submissions against pre-approved artist budgets.
  • Rigorously verify that incoming invoices match approved artist scopes and ensure accurate tracking and coding of recoupable expenses.
  • Direct the strategic oversight of staff and artist travel via the Manager of Travel Operations, ensuring strict adherence to travel policies and budget caps.
  • Oversee the auditing and reconciliation of all BREX transactions, ensuring all charges are properly documented, audited, and charged back to the appropriate label accounts.
